  3. This is different from QAM channels. If you were to hook up an antenna you would receive a small amount of digital channels for free and some are even in HD. A QAM tuner in your TV will display the same channels. At least it does in my area. Comcast cannot block those channels. If they do the FCC will be all over their asses.
  4. The QAM channels have not dissappeared, they just moved the channels around. From what I understand, the FCC mandates that they broadcast these channels un-encrypted and they cannot be blocked. Try hooking up some bunny ears and see if you can get them that way. Don't call Comcast about it either because they will swear that the QAM channels don't exist. They want people to think you can't watch TV at all unless you buy one of their boxes. Comcast sucks, but its all I have available in my area. I have a digital box in the living room but I just watch the free QAM channels in the bedroom.
